Shakespeare’s Globe Theatre Stands 400 Years and Only Yards Away From the Original. Completed in 1997, Shakespeare’s Globe Theatre is third Globe Theatre to have been built on the Southbank of the Thames. The original Globes were located just a street further back from the river.
